61 Pa. Code § 6.6 - Payment
(a) Except as
provided in subsections (e) and (f), full payment of an eligible tax liability
and an eligible interest liability shall be made during the amnesty period only
by cashier's check, certified check or money order made payable to "PA Dept. of
Revenue" or by cash.
(b) A taxpayer
may not pay an eligible tax liability or an eligible interest liability by
electronic means.
(c) A taxpayer
that is currently making payments to the Department pursuant to a deferred
payment plan may participate in the Program if the taxpayer meets the
requirements for participation as specified in §
6.4 (relating to participation
requirements).
(d) Except as
provided in subsections (e) and (f), if at the end of the amnesty period, a
taxpayer has paid less than the full amount of its eligible tax liability and
eligible interest liability, the Department will apply the total amount paid to
the taxpayer's account but will not abate an eligible penalty
liability.
(e) If a taxpayer has
not correctly calculated the amount of eligible interest liability that must be
paid, the Department will recalculate the amount due and will send the taxpayer
a billing notice stating the correct eligible interest liability. If the
taxpayer does not pay the amount shown as due on the billing notice no later
than 30 days after the mailing date of the billing notice or by the end of the
amnesty period, whichever is later, the taxpayer will no longer be eligible to
participate in the Program.
(f) A
taxpayer that can substantiate a severe financial hardship will be permitted to
enter into a deferred payment plan for the payment of eligible liabilities.
Eligible penalty liabilities will not be abated.
